What is Big Solitaires 3D?




A brief introduction to the game and its features




Big Solitaires 3D is a free and open-source game developed by fjcladellas. It was released in 2007 and has been updated several times since then. The latest version is 1.4, which was released in October 2022.

The game features four different bitmap decks, new image backgrounds, an option to load your own personal image background, a few extra jazzy transitional effects, and the game Klondike. You can also choose from three different card sizes, three different card back colors, and three different card face colors.


The game has a simple and intuitive interface that allows you to easily select the game you want to play, adjust the settings, view the rules, and access the help menu. You can also switch between fullscreen or window mode in any resolution supported by your graphics card.


The benefits of playing solitaire games




Solitaire games are not only fun and relaxing, but they also have some benefits for your brain and mental health. Here are some of them:



  • They improve your concentration and focus. Solitaire games require you to pay attention to the cards, the rules, and the moves. They also challenge you to plan ahead and think strategically.



  • They enhance your memory and cognitive skills. Solitaire games involve remembering the cards that have been played, the cards that are left in the deck or in the tableau, and the possible outcomes of each move. They also stimulate your logical thinking and problem-solving abilities.



  • They reduce your stress and anxiety levels. Solitaire games are a great way to unwind and relax after a long day. They can also distract you from negative thoughts and emotions, and help you cope with difficult situations.



  • They boost your mood and self-esteem. Solitaire games can make you feel happy and satisfied when you complete a game or achieve a high score. They can also increase your confidence and motivation when you overcome a challenge or learn a new skill.



How to Download and Install Big Solitaires 3D?




The system requirements and compatibility




Before you download and install Big Solit aires 3D, you need to make sure that your computer meets the minimum system requirements and is compatible with the game. Here are the specifications you need:



  • Operating system: Windows XP, Vista, 7, 8, or 10



  • Processor: Pentium III 800 MHz or higher



  • Memory: 256 MB RAM or higher



  • Graphics: OpenGL compatible graphics card with 32 MB VRAM or higher



  • Sound: DirectX compatible sound card



  • Hard disk space: 50 MB free space or higher



The game is also available for Linux and Mac OS X, but you may need to compile it from the source code. You can find the instructions on how to do that on the official website of the game. Alternatively, you can use a software like Wine or CrossOver to run the Windows version of the game on your Linux or Mac computer.

How to Play Big Solitaires 3D?




The main menu and options




When you launch Big Solitaires 3D, you will see the main menu with four options: Play, Options, Help, and Exit. Here is what each option does:



  • Play: This option allows you to start playing one of the 40 solitaire games available in the game. You can choose from a list of games sorted by name, type, or difficulty. You can also filter the games by selecting one of the categories at the top of the screen: All Games, Popular Games, Easy Games, Medium Games, Hard Games, or Favorites Games. To select a game, simply click on its name and then click on "Play".



  • Options: This option allows you to customize your game experience by changing various settings. You can adjust the graphics quality, the sound volume, the card size, the card back color, the card face color, and the background image. You can also enable or disable some features, such as animations, shadows, reflections, antialiasing, music, sound effects, hints, and statistics. To apply your changes, click on "OK". To restore the default settings, click on "Default".



  • Help: This option allows you to access the help menu where you can find useful information about the game. You can view the rules of each solitaire game, as well as some general tips and tricks. You can also view the credits of the game and check for updates.



  • Exit: This option allows you to quit the game and return to your desktop.
